Knowledge of laboratory process and safety training is needed as well. Each time blood is taken as a sample, care should be given to how this is done and the way the equipment is disposed of. An accident with a needle or with the tagging of samples can have awful results. This is often either to the phlebotomist or the patient. A phlebotomist has the job of drawing blood from patients. After a tube was filled, another tube may be connected or the needle can be taken off. In case the phlebotomy technician has gathered a reasonable volume of blood, they will often remove the needle and put a dressing on the puncture site.

After you finish your online training courses, you'll need to pass various tests performed by the American Society for Clinical Pathology (ASCP), the American Medical Technologists and American Association of Medical Staff, to be a certified phlebotomist. Phlebotomy programs are offered by some Phlebotomy schools for those who possess the interest in joining the health care industry. Students in Phlebotomy courses are taught by the school on how to collect blood as well as process it. Other than that, students are additionally trained about CPR. Determined by your location, your state generally requires you to become licensed through one of six agencies that give certification examinations for phlebotomists--including the National Phlebotomy Association, the ASCP, as well as the National Accrediting Agency for Clinical Laboratory Sciences.
